RESUMO

BACKGROUND: Acute flaccid paralysis (AFP) is characterized by rapidly progressive limb weakness with low muscle tone. It has a broad differential diagnosis, which includes acute flaccid myelitis (AFM), a rare polio-like condition that mainly affects young children. Differentiation between AFM and other causes of AFP may be difficult, particularly at onset of disease. Here, we evaluate the diagnostic criteria for AFM and compare AFM to other causes of acute weakness in children, aiming to identify differentiating clinical and diagnostic features. METHODS: The diagnostic criteria for AFM were applied to a cohort of children with acute onset of limb weakness. An initial classification based on positive diagnostic criteria was compared to the final classification, based on application of features suggestive for an alternative diagnosis and discussion with expert neurologists. Cases classified as definite, probable, or possible AFM or uncertain, were compared to cases with an alternative diagnosis. RESULTS: Of 141 patients, seven out of nine patients initially classified as definite AFM, retained this label after further classification. For probable AFM, this was 3/11, for possible AFM 3/14 and for uncertain 11/43. Patients initially classified as probable or possible AFM were most commonly diagnosed with transverse myelitis (16/25). If the initial classification was uncertain, Guillain-Barré syndrome was the most common diagnosis (31/43). Clinical and diagnostic features not included in the diagnostic criteria, were often used for the final classification. CONCLUSION: The current diagnostic criteria for AFM usually perform well, but additional features are sometimes required to distinguish AFM from other conditions.

RESUMO

BACKGROUND: Prostate cancer (PC) is the most common type of neoplasm in men and the fourth leading cause of mortality in Brazil. The prostate cancer refractory metastatic castration can be treated with abiraterone acetate (AA). CASE PRESENTATION: Its use has been associated with increased survival. However, there are also side effects associated with the use of this drug, such as severe electrolyte disturbances. CONCLUSION: The objective is to report the clinical case of a patient with castration-resistant metastatic prostate cancer who developed ascending flaccid paralysis secondary to severe hypokalemia, probably due to hyperaldosteronism secondary to the use of Abiraterone Acetate, despite the use of Prednisone.

RESUMO

The use of cervical facet spacers has shown favorable clinical results in the treatment of cervical spondylotic disease; however, there are limited data regarding neurological complications associated with the procedure. This case report demonstrates the specificity of multi-myotomal motor evoked potentials (MEPs) in detecting acute postoperative C5 palsy following placement of facet spacers. A posterior cervical fusion with decompression and instrumentation involving DTRAX (Providence Medical Technology; Lafayette, CA) was used to treat a patient with cervical stenosis and myelopathy. Intraoperative neurophysiological monitoring (IONM) consisting of MEPs, somatosensory evoked potentials (SSEPs), and free-run electromyography (EMG), was used throughout the procedure. Immediately following the placement of the DTRAX spacers at C4-5, a decrease in amplitudes from the right deltoid and biceps MEP recordings (>65%) was detected. All other IONM modalities remained stable; it is noteworthy that there was an absence of mechanically elicited EMG. A novel post-alert regression analysis trending algorithm of MEP amplitudes confirmed the visual alert. This warning along with an intraoperative computed tomography (CT) scan of the cervical spine subsequently resulted in the decision to remove one of the facet spacers. Surgical intervention did not result in recovery of the aforementioned MEP recordings, which remained attenuated at the time of wound closure. Postoperatively, the patient exhibited an immediate right C5 palsy (2/5). A post-surgery application of the trending algorithm demonstrated that it correlated to the visual alert until the end of monitoring.

RESUMO

STUDY DESIGN: A prospective multicenter observational study. OBJECTIVE: The aim was to investigate the validity of transcranial motor-evoked potentials (Tc-MEP) in cervical spine surgery and identify factors associated with positive predictive value when Tc-MEP alerts are occurred. SUMMARY OF BACKGROUND DATA: The sensitivity and specificity of Tc-MEP for detecting motor paralysis are high; however, false-positives sometimes occur. MATERIALS AND METHODS: The authors examined Tc-MEP in 2476 cases of cervical spine surgeries and compared patient backgrounds, type of spinal disorders, preoperative motor status, surgical factors, and the types of Tc-MEP alerts. Tc-MEP alerts were defined as an amplitude reduction of more than 70% from the control waveform. Tc-MEP results were classified into two groups: false-positive and true-positive, and items that showed significant differences were extracted by univariate analysis and detected by multivariate analysis. RESULTS: Overall sensitivity was 66% (segmental paralysis: 33% and lower limb paralysis: 95.8%) and specificity was 91.5%. Tc-MEP outcomes were 33 true-positives and 233 false-positives. Positive predictive value of general spine surgery was significantly higher in cases with a severe motor status than in a nonsevere motor status (19.5% vs . 6.7%, P =0.02), but not different in high-risk spine surgery (20.8% vs . 19.4%). However, rescue rates did not significantly differ regardless of motor status (48% vs . 50%). In a multivariate logistic analysis, a preoperative severe motor status [ P =0.041, odds ratio (OR): 2.46, 95% confidence interval (95% CI): 1.03-5.86] and Tc-MEP alerts during intradural tumor resection ( P <0.001, OR: 7.44, 95% CI: 2.64-20.96) associated with true-positives, while Tc-MEP alerts that could not be identified with surgical maneuvers ( P =0.011, OR: 0.23, 95% CI: 0.073-0.71) were associated with false-positives. CONCLUSION: The utility of Tc-MEP in patients with a preoperative severe motor status was enhanced, even in those without high-risk spine surgery. Regardless of the motor status, appropriate interventions following Tc-MEP alerts may prevent postoperative paralysis.

RESUMO

STUDY DESIGN: A retrospective clinical study. OBJECTIVE: To elucidate the usefulness of the patellar tendon reflex (PTR), bulbocavernosus reflex (BCR), and plantar response (PR) as factors in the prognostic prediction of motor function in complete paralysis due to cervical spinal cord injuries (CSCIs) at the acute phase. SETTING: Department of Orthopedic Surgery, Spinal Injuries Center, Japan. METHODS: 99 patients assessed as the American Spinal Injury Association Impairment Scale (AIS) grade A (AIS A) were included in this study. The PTR, BCR, and PR were evaluated respectively as positive or negative at the time of injury. We classified the patients into two groups based on their neurological recovery at 3 months after injury: "recovered" group was defined as AIS C, D, or E; "non-recovered" group was defined as AIS A or B. RESULTS: Eight patients demonstrated positive PTR, while 91 demonstrated negative. Three out of eight patients with positive PTR (37.5%) were R group, while 83 out of 91 patients with negative PTR (91.2%) were N group. A significant difference was observed (p = 0.043). For BCR, no significant difference was observed (p > 0.05). Twenty-six patients demonstrated positive PTR, while 73 demonstrated negative. Nine out of twenty-six patients with positive PR (34.6%) were R group, while 71 out of 73 patients with negative PR (97.3%) were N group. A significant difference was observed (p = 0.000068). CONCLUSION: The PTR and PR are useful for poor prognostic prediction of motor function in CSCI at the acute phase.

Objective: To determine outcomes of treatment options for binocular diplopia in patients with oculomotor paresis or paralysis. Method: A descriptive, longitudinal and prospective study was carried out of a series of cases that were assisted at the consultation of the Pediatric Ophthalmology Service at Ramón Pando Ferrer Cuban Institute of Ophthalmology. The variables evaluated were age, sex, etiology, treatment options, limitation of ocular movements, elimination of diplopia, fusion and stereopsis. Results: The microvascular etiology was the most frequent. 66.7 percent of the studied sample was resolved only with medical treatment, 100.0 percent of them had a diagnosis of paresis or paralysis of the third cranial nerve, followed by the sixth and fourth with 63.6 percent and 33.3 percent, respectively. Six patients required medical and surgical treatment and application of botulinum toxin, 33.3 percent of the fourth and 22.7 percent of the sixth cranial nerve. The rest of the treatment options with only one patient. No significant association was found between treatment options and affected cranial nerve. 86.6 percent finished without limitation of eye movements. 86.7 percent of cases eliminated diplopia in all diagnostic gaze positions. 76.7 percent achieved fusion and 56.7 percent stereopsis. Conclusions: Medical treatment and combined medical treatment plus botulinum toxin injection and extraocular muscle surgery were the most used options and allowed ocular alignment and elimination of binocular diplopia(AU)

RESUMO

STUDY DESIGN: Retrospective study. OBJECTIVE: To determine the risk factors for insufficient recovery from C5 palsy (C5P) following anterior cervical decompression and fusion (ADF). SUMMARY OF BACKGROUND DATA: Postoperative C5P is a frequent but unsolved complication following cervical decompression surgery. Although most patients gradually recover, some recover only partially. When we encounter new-onset C5P following ADF, the question that often arises is whether the palsy will sufficiently resolve. METHODS: We retrospectively reviewed consecutive patients who underwent ADF at our institution. We defined C5P as postoperative deterioration of deltoid muscle strength by two or more grades determined by manual muscle testing (MMT). We evaluated the following demographic data: patient factors, surgical factors, and radiological findings. C5P patients were divided into two groups: sufficient recovery (MMT grade≧4) and insufficient recovery (MMT grade < 4). Each parameter was compared between the two groups. RESULTS: Of 839 patients initially included in the study, 57 experienced new-onset C5P (6.8%). At the final follow-up (mean, 55 ±â€Š17 months), 41 patients experienced sufficient recovery, whereas 16 (28%) still exhibited insufficient recovery. Compared with the sufficient recovery group, patients with insufficient recovery exhibited a higher decompression combination score, a larger anterior shift in preoperative cervical sagittal balance, less lordosis of the pre- and postoperative C4/C5 segment, more frequent stenosis at the C3/C4 segment, lower deltoid strength at C5P onset, more frequent co-occurrence of biceps weakness, greater postoperative expansion of the dura mater, and more frequent presence of postoperative T2 high-intensity areas. Multivariate analysis revealed that co-occurrence of biceps muscle weakness, less lordosis at the preoperative C4/C5 segment, and postoperative expansion of the dura mater were independent predictors of insufficient recovery. CONCLUSION: The combination of unfavorable conditions, such as potential spinal cord disorder, cervical malalignment, and excessive expansion of the dura mater after corpectomy, predicts insufficient recovery from C5P.Level of Evidence: 4.

RESUMO

INTRODUCTION: In May 2020, a novel cryoballoon system (POLARx; Boston Scientific) became available for catheter ablation of atrial fibrillation (AF). The design of the cryoballoon is comparable to the Arctic Front Advance Pro (AFA-Pro; Medtronic), but it is more compliant during freezing. We compared the procedural efficacy, biophysical parameters, and risk of phrenic nerve palsy (PNP) between the two cryoballoons. METHODS: Embase, MEDLINE, Web of Science, Cochrane, and Google Scholar databases were searched until June 1, 2021 for relevant studies comparing POLARx versus AFA-Pro in patients undergoing pulmonary vein isolation (PVI) for AF. RESULTS: A total of four studies, involving 310 patients were included. There was no difference between the two groups for outcomes regarding procedural efficacy: acute PVI (odds ratio [OR]: 0.43; 95% confidence interval [CI]: 0.06 to 3.03; p = .40), procedure time (mean difference [MD]: 8.15 min; 95% CI: -8.09 to 24.39; p = .33), fluoroscopy time (MD: 1.32 min; 95% CI: -1.61 to 4.25; p = .38) and ablation time (MD: 1.00 min; 95% CI: -0.20 to 2.20; p = .10). The balloon nadir temperature was lower for all individual pulmonary veins (PV) in POLARx compared with AFA-Pro (MD: -9.74°C, -9.98°C, -6.72°C, -7.76°C, for left superior PV, left inferior PV, right superior PV, and right inferior PV, respectively; all p < .001). The incidence of PNP was similar between groups (OR: 0.79; 95% CI: 0.22 to 2.85; p = .72). CONCLUSION: In AF patients undergoing PVI, POLARx and AFA-Pro had a similar procedural efficacy. Balloon nadir temperatures were lower with POLARx, however, the incidence of PNP was similar.

RESUMO

BACKGROUND: C5 nerve root paralysis is a nonnegligible complication after posterior cervical spine surgery (PCSS). The cause of its occurrence remains controversial. The purpose of this study was to analyse the incidence of and risk factors for C5 nerve root paralysis after posterior cervical decompression. METHODS: We retrospectively analysed the clinical data of 640 patients who underwent PCSS in the Department of Orthopaedics, Affiliated Hospital of Qingdao University from September 2013 to September 2019. According to the status of C5 nerve root paralysis after surgery, all patients were divided into paralysis and normal groups. Univariate and multivariate analyses were used to determine the independent risk factors for C5 nerve root paralysis. A receiver operating characteristic (ROC) curve was used to demonstrate the discrimination of all independent risk factors. RESULTS: Multivariate logistic regression analysis revealed that male sex, preoperative cervical spine curvature, posterior longitudinal ligament ossification, and preoperative C4/5 spinal cord hyperintensity were independent risk factors for paralysis, whereas the width of the intervertebral foramina was an independent protective factor for paralysis. The area under the curve (AUC) values of the T2 signal change at C4-C5, sex, cervical foramina width, curvature and posterior longitudinal ligament ossification were 0.706, 0.633, 0.617, 0.637, and 0.569, respectively. CONCLUSIONS: Male patients with C4-C5 intervertebral foramina stenosis, preoperative C4-C5 spinal cord T2 high signal, combined with OPLL, and higher preoperative cervical spine curvature are more likely to develop C5 nerve root paralysis after surgery. Among the above five risk factors, T2 hyperintensity change in C4-C5 exhibits the highest correlation with C5 paralysis and strong diagnostic power. It seems necessary to inform patients who have had cervical spine T2 hyperintensity before surgery of C5 nerve root paralysis after surgery, especially those with altered spinal cord T2 signals in the C4-C5 segment.

RESUMO

Case 1: A 73-year-old man who had undergone neurolysis for right cubital tunnel syndrome complained of difficulty using chopsticks. Froment's sign test showed that the interphalangeal(IP)joint of the right thumb that had flexed preoperatively was extended. This finding was considered to indicate recovery from ulnar neuropathy, and the patient was closely followed up. One year later, the patient was unable to push a camera shutter button and was unable to flex the IP joint of the thumb and the distal interphalangeal(DIP)joint of the index finger, a characteristic symptom of anterior interosseous nerve(AIN)palsy. Therefore, the patient underwent AIN neurolysis and subsequently reported slight improvement in his condition. Case 2: A 60-year-old woman reported difficulty performing computer mouse clicks with her right hand. As flexing the index finger DIP joint was difficult, a local lesion was suspected, and the patient was closely followed up. One year later, the patient was unable to push the button of a ballpoint pen with her thumb. Extension of the thumb and index finger indicated AIN palsy. The patient refused treatment and was only followed up. The following year, the patient reported that the weakness improved. Simultaneous flexion palsy of the thumb and index finger can lead to a diagnosis of AIN palsy. However, flexion palsy of a single finger in incomplete AIN palsy, as reported here, is often overlooked because of its similarity to the flexor tendon rupture. Awareness regarding this incomplete form of AIN palsy is needed for early and correct diagnosis.

RESUMO

Some cases of acute spinal cord paralysis by epidural hematoma have made complete recovery through natural progression. This group cannot be ignored in choosing a therapy. We have considered the applications of non-operative observation and the optimal timing to convert to surgical intervention. Of the 454 cases reported, cases that were of trauma/post-operative, undergone epidural block, lumbosacral level, paralysis-free, were excluded. 10 clinical items were identified as factors related to the outcome of therapy, and a total of 142 cases (73 surgical and 69 non-surgical/observation cases) which included all items in its record, were extracted for this study. 104 cases that made complete recovery from spinal paralysis (CR) includes 65 cases without surgical intervention (NOP-CR). Using "paralysis recovery start time (PRST)", ROC analysis was conducted to show the diagnostic time needed to detect the cases of CR and NOP-CR. Clinical characteristics of CR and NOP-CR were identified using multiple logistics regression analysis. CR probability were higher at PRST < 15 h from the onset and NOP-CR was even higher at < 11 h. Three clinical items: incomplete motor paralysis, no use of anti-coagulant therapy, and PRST within 15 h were found to be the characteristics of CR and NOP-CR. The case with all 3 items; especially PRST within 11 h from onset, is applicable to non-operative observation. Immediate surgical intervention at 6-hours is recommended in cases that presented with unchanged complete motor paralysis. Observation treatment is discontinued and converted to surgery if motor usefulness is not regained at 15-hours.

RESUMO

A 4-year-old American Quarter Horse gelding was evaluated for acute non-weight-bearing lameness of the right thoracic limb with swelling in the right shoulder region. Physical examination revealed radial nerve paralysis of unknown etiology. The primary differential diagnosis was musculoskeletal trauma. Ultrasonography of the right shoulder region identified a heterogeneous mass that extended from the point of the shoulder to the thoracic inlet. Cytologic analysis of fluid collected by fine needle aspirate of the mass was consistent with large cell lymphoma. Based on the cytological findings, locally invasive neoplasia was diagnosed and considered the likely cause of the radial nerve paralysis. Because of the poor prognosis, the horse was euthanized, and postmortem examination confirmed the diagnosis of a nonclassified large cell lymphoma that extended from the deep tissues of the right pectoral muscle group into the thoracic inlet and pleural cavity, as well as the right brachial plexus. The mass in the region of the brachial plexus encompassed and mechanically compressed all of the nerves within the area, resulting in the clinical sign of radial nerve paralysis. Although neoplasia as a cause of radial nerve paralysis is rare, it should be considered as a differential diagnosis, regardless of age.

RESUMO

After a low-energy fall, an 83-year-old man presented with bilateral weakness of the upper arms without loss of sensation associated with a rigid cervical spine (ankylosing spinal disorder, ASD). Because of an atypical presentation during history, examination and initial imaging, a late diagnosis of a transdiscal C4-C5 fracture was made by dynamic radiographs. Anterior cervical discectomy and fusion were performed with delay. Strength improved from grade C to D (American Spinal Injury Association classification) after surgery. To our knowledge, this is the first description of a bilateral, isolated upper limb C5 paralysis without any loss of sensation caused by a transdiscal C4-C5 fracture. A high clinical and diagnostic index of suspicion is mandatory to make the diagnosis. We present three clinical 'Awareness Criteria' (1: recognition of ASD; 2: high index of fracture suspicion; 3: necessary imaging) helping clinicians to safely and promptly diagnose occult spinal fractures in ASD.

RESUMO

While phrenic nerve palsy (PNP) due to cryoballoon pulmonary vein isolation (PVI) of atrial fibrillation (AF) was transient in most cases, no studies have reported the results of the long-term follow-up of PNP. This study aimed to summarize details and the results of long-term follow-up of PNP after cryoballoon ablation. A total of 511 consecutive AF patients who underwent cryoballoon ablation was included. During right-side PVI, the diaphragmatic compound motor action potential (CMAP) was reduced in 46 (9.0%) patients and PNP occurred in 29 (5.7%) patients (during right-superior PVI in 20 patients and right-inferior PVI in 9 patients). PNP occurred despite the absence of CMAP reduction in 0.6%. The PV anatomy, freezing parameters and the operator's proficiency were not predictors of PNP. While PNP during RSPVI persisted more than 4 years in 3 (0.6%) patients, all PNP occurred during RIPVI recovered until one year after the ablation. However, there was no significant difference in the recovery duration from PNP between PNP during RSPVI and RIPVI. PNP occurred during cryoballoon ablation in 5.7%. While most patients recovered from PNP within one year after the ablation, PNP during RSPVI persisted more than 4 years in 0.6% of patients.

RESUMO

PURPOSE: To investigate the feasibility of both needle electromyography (EMG) and proximal nerve conduction studies (NCS) in predicting C5 palsy after posterior cervical decompression. METHODS: This study included 192 patients with cervical myelopathy undergoing laminoplasty or laminectomy. Preoperatively, all patients accepted bilateral needle EMG detection and proximal NCS that consisted of supramaximally stimulating Erb's point and recording compound muscle action potential (CMAP) from bilateral deltoid. RESULTS: In the present study, 11 (11/192, 5.7%) patients developed unilateral C5 palsy after operation, and more patients with C5 palsy showed abnormal spontaneous activity in C5-innervated muscles compared to those without C5 palsy (8/11 vs. 16/181, p < 0.05). The sensitivity and specificity of spontaneous activity in C5-innervated muscles in predicting postoperative C5 palsy were 72.7% and 91.2%, respectively. Furthermore, there were significant left-to-right differences of deltoid CMAP amplitudes between the patients with and without C5 palsy (p < 0.05), and this measurement was also demonstrated to be useful for distinguishing patients with C5 palsy from cases without C5 palsy by receiver operating characteristic (ROC) curve analysis (cut-off value: 2.1 mV, sensitivity: 63.6%; specificity: 95.0%). In addition, the sensitivity and specificity of a series application of these two measurements were 63.6% and 100.0%, respectively. CONCLUSIONS: The findings of this study support the hypothesis that pre-existing progressive C5 root injury may be a risk factor for C5 palsy after posterior cervical decompression. Clinically, the estimation of NCS and needle EMG in C5-innervated muscles may provide additional useful information for predicting C5 palsy after cervical spinal surgery. RESUMO

BACKGROUND: Clinical characteristics and timing associated with nonsurgical recovery of upper extremity function in acute flaccid myelitis are unknown. METHODS: A single-institution retrospective case series was analyzed to describe clinical features of acute flaccid myelitis diagnosed between October of 2013 and December of 2016. Patients were consecutively sampled children with a diagnosis of acute flaccid myelitis who were referred to a hand surgeon. Patient factors and initial severity of paralysis were compared with upper extremity muscle strength outcomes using the Medical Research Council scale every 3 months up to 18 months after onset. RESULTS: Twenty-two patients with acute flaccid myelitis (aged 2 to 16 years) were studied. Proximal upper extremity musculature was more frequently and severely affected, with 56 percent of patients affected bilaterally. Functional recovery of all muscle groups (≥M3) in an individual limb was observed in 43 percent of upper extremities within 3 months. Additional complete limb recovery to greater than or equal to M3 after 3 months was rarely observed. Extraplexal paralysis, including spinal accessory (72 percent), glossopharyngeal/hypoglossal (28 percent), lower extremity (28 percent), facial (22 percent), and phrenic nerves (17 percent), was correlated with greater severity of upper extremity paralysis and decreased spontaneous recovery. There was no correlation between severity of paralysis or recovery and patient characteristics, including age, sex, comorbidities, prodromal symptoms, or time to paralysis. CONCLUSIONS: Spontaneous functional limb recovery, if present, occurred early, within 3 months of the onset of paralysis. The authors recommend that patients without signs of early recovery warrant consideration for early surgical intervention and referral to a hand surgeon or other specialist in peripheral nerve injury. RESUMO

STUDY DESIGN: A systematic review and meta-analysis were performed with the literature including the case of C5 palsy following anterior cervical decompression surgery. OBJECTIVE: The aim of this study was to compare three reconstructive procedures of anterior cervical decompression, the incidences of delayed C5 palsy and other complications were assessed. SUMMARY OF BACKGROUND DATA: Delayed C5 palsy is now a well-known complication after cervical decompression surgery. The etiology of C5 palsy has been studied, especially after posterior surgery. However, in anterior surgery there has been a lack of investigation due to procedure variation. Additionally, limited evidence exists regarding the risk of C5 palsy in surgical procedures. METHODS: We performed an extensive literature search for C5 palsy and other complications with ACDF, ACCF, and their combination (Hybrid). Gross incidences of C5 palsy after these three procedures were compared, and specific superiorities (or inferiorities) were investigated via comparison of binary outcomes between two of three groups using odds ratios (OR). RESULTS: Twenty-six studies met the inclusion criteria. A total of 3098 patients were included and 5.8% of those developed C5 palsy. Meta-analyses demonstrated that ACDF had a lower risk of palsy than ACCF (OR 0.36, 95% confidence interval [CI] 0.16-0.78), whereas ACDF versus Hybrid (OR 0.60, 95% CI 0.24-1.51) and Hybrid versus ACCF (OR 1.11, 95% CI 0.29-4.32) were not significantly different. Although these differences were not observed in shorter lesion subgroups, there were significant differences between the three procedures in longer lesion subgroups (P = 0.0005). Meta-analyses revealed that in longer lesions, ACDF had a significantly lower incidence than ACCF (OR 0.42, 95% CI 0.22-0.82). Additionally, Hybrid surgery was noninferior for palsy occurrence compared to ACCF, and suggested a trend for reduced rates of other complications compared to ACCF. CONCLUSION: ACDF may yield better outcomes than Hybrid and ACCF. Furthermore, Hybrid may have advantages over ACCF in terms of surgical complications. LEVEL OF EVIDENCE: 3.

RESUMO

INTRODUCTION: The smaller cross-sectional areas of the dural sacs in patients without C5 palsy after posterior cervical spine surgery may lead to less neurological improvement. OBJECTIVES: The aim of this retrospective study was to clarify the differences in the cross-sectional area of the dural sac in the cervical spine and neurological improvement in patients with and without C5 palsy after posterior cervical spinal surgery. METHODS: We retrospectively evaluated the postoperative cross-sectional areas of the dural sacs and neurological outcomes in patients with and without C5 palsy after posterior cervical spine surgery. We compared the postoperative cross-sectional areas of the dural sac at C4/5 and C5/6 on magnetic resonance images between the C5 palsy group (n = 19) and the no-C5 palsy group (n = 84) after posterior cervical spinal surgery 1 year postoperatively. Performance tests, namely, the 10-s grip-and-release test and the 10-s single-foot-tapping (FT) test, were compared between the two groups. RESULTS: Postoperative cross-sectional areas of the dural sac at C4/5 and C5/6 (233.3 mm2 and 226.6 mm2, respectively) in the C5 palsy group were significantly larger (P = 0.0036 and P = 0.0039, respectively) than those (195.0 mm2 and 193.8 mm2, respectively) in the no-C5 palsy group. Postoperative gain in the grip-and-release test was similar between the two groups. Postoperative gain in the FT test (4.9 times) in the C5 palsy group was significantly larger (P = 0.0060) than that (1.8 times) in the no-C5 palsy group. CONCLUSIONS: In the C5 palsy group 1 year after posterior cervical spine surgery, the cross-sectional areas of the dural sac were larger, and the 10-s single FT test improved noticeably.

RESUMO

A 38-year-old woman presented with a history of recurrent episodes of transient loss of consciousness (TLOC) with seizure-like activity and post-TLOC left sided paresis. Electroencephalogram and MRI of the brain were normal, and events were not controlled by anti-convulsant therapy. Tilt testing produced reflex mixed pattern vasovagal syncope, with exact symptom reproduction, including bilateral upper and lower limb myoclonic movements and post-TLOC left hemiparesis that persisted for 27 min. A witness for the tilt event confirmed reproduction of patients 'typical' TLOC event. Syncope is the most frequent cause of TLOC. Myoclonic movements during syncope are not uncommon and can be misdiagnosed as epilepsy. It is rare to experience paresis after syncope, which in this case, lead to misdiagnosis and unnecessary anti-convulsant treatment.

RESUMO

Keraunoparalysis is a transient paralysis of the extremities, which results from close contact with lightning. In this case report, a 58-year-old man came in close contact with a bolt of lightning. His left foot was pulseless, pale, cold and with absence of capillary refill. His symptoms were initially interpreted as arterial occlusion, and therefore bypass surgery and even amputation were considered. However, his symptoms resolved within hours. Therefore, clinicians must consider keranoparalysis as a differential diagnosis in patients struck by lightning.
